What is the worlds largest SUV?

Ford Excursion

The Ford Excursion is the world's largest SUV. It was produced by Ford Motor Company from 1999 to 2005. The Excursion was based on the Ford F-250 Super Duty pickup truck. It was offered in two lengths: a standard-length model with a wheelbase of 137 inches, and an extended-length model with a wheelbase of 156 inches. The Excursion had a seating capacity of up to nine passengers and a cargo capacity of up to 109 cubic feet. It was powered by a 5.4-liter or 6.8-liter V10 gasoline engine. The Excursion was discontinued in 2005 due to poor sales.
